1. Why You Need a Divorce Lawyer in New York in 2024
Divorce in New York can become legally complicated due to state-specific rules like equitable distribution of property, custody, and alimony. A knowledgeable divorce lawyer helps you understand these complexities, ensuring your rights are protected.
- Property Division: New York follows an equitable distribution approach, where marital property is divided fairly, not necessarily equally.
- Child Custody & Support: New York prioritizes the “best interests of the child,” impacting custody decisions and child support calculations.
- Alimony & Spousal Support: Spousal maintenance is governed by factors like the length of the marriage and the income disparity between spouses.
2. Qualities to Look for in a Divorce Lawyer in New York
Choosing the right divorce lawyer is key to achieving favorable outcomes. Here are the essential qualities to consider:
- Experience & Specialization: Look for lawyers with a strong track record in family law cases.
- Knowledge of Current Laws: Familiarity with the latest legal developments and case laws is crucial.
- Reputation & Client Testimonials: Check for reviews, client feedback, and the lawyer’s standing in the legal community.
- Transparent Fees & Case Strategy: Understand their billing structure and approach to handling divorce cases, whether through litigation or mediation.
